Simpli-Fi by CFA
This loan is designed to provide financing for your agronomy and related services purchased at your local cooperative. The loan can be up to $1,000,000 based on information submitted in the Simpli-Fi by CFA Loan Application. The loan is simple to use as the loan application and loan documentation are combined into one document.
CFA's input financing programs, supported by the Field Finance platform, help retailers and cooperatives offer competitive, convenient credit for crop inputs while managing risk and improving cash flow. Producers gain predictable terms and simplified borrowing, while cooperatives retain and deepen relationships in their trade area.
